Palaces of Reason traces the fascinating history of three royal
residences built outside of Naples in the eighteenth century at
Capodimonte, Portici, and Caserta. Commissioned by King Charles of
Bourbon and Queen Maria Amalia of Saxony, who reigned over the
Kingdom of the Two Sicilies, these buildings were far more than
residences for the monarchs. They were designed to help reshape the
economic and cultural fortunes of the realm. The palaces at
Capodimonte, Portici, and Caserta are among the most complex
architectural commissions of the eighteenth century. Considering
the architecture and decoration of these complexes within their
political, cultural, and economic contexts, Robin L. Thomas argues
that Enlightenment ideas spurred their construction and influenced
their decoration. These modes of thinking saw the palaces as more
than just centers of royal pleasure or muscular assertions of the
crown’s power. Indeed, writers and royal ministers viewed them as
active agents in improving the cultural, political, social, and
economic health of the kingdom. By casting the palaces within this
narrative, Thomas counters the assumption that they were imitations
of Versailles and the swan songs of absolutism, while expanding our
understanding of the eighteenth-century European palace more
broadly. Original and convincing, Thomas’s book will be of
interest to historians of art and architectural history and
eighteenth-century studies.
